im assuming your talking about header.. anyway how much longer do you plan on keeping the car? or moreso.. are you going turbo later? if you plan on keeping it forevery/until the motor dies and leaving it N/A.. then i'd get stainless..

however if you are planning on 1)turbo'ing the car later on or 2) trading it in a few years from now (or sooner).. then i'd get Ceramic..

performance wise their both pretty much the same.. Ceramic is made of milder steel.. and is ceramic coated.. the stainless will look better when new.. nice and shiny.. but will bronze/brown/purple out as it goes through use/heating cycles... if your planning on keeping the car for a long time.. i'd get stainless.. if not get ceramic..
